免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12
最近访问板块 发新帖
楼主: qm
打印 上一主题 下一主题

关于LIB及其下的OBJECT的使用权限的问题 [复制链接]

论坛徽章:
0
11 [报告]
发表于 2004-03-30 17:57 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

那是不可能的 PUBLIC的权限放开了就等于给其他用户授权了

如果能做到象你所说的那样 那PUBLIC *EXCLUDE还有意义么??

论坛徽章:
0
12 [报告]
发表于 2004-03-31 08:11 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

如果不信你可以自己申请一个TEXAS400的帐户去看看情况是否是我说的那样!
正因为不明白,所以对这个事实我是反复确认了的!

论坛徽章:
0
13 [报告]
发表于 2004-03-31 08:51 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

首先你要确认你对他的LIB是否有权限? 接着是对SOURCE FILE是否有权限?
你用WRKOBJ看的是PGM的授权吧?

论坛徽章:
0
14 [报告]
发表于 2004-03-31 09:48 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题


  1.                          Display Object Authority
  2. Object . . . . . . . :   USR5184         Owner  . . . . . . . :   USR5184
  3.    Library  . . . . . :     QSYS          Primary group  . . . :   *NONE
  4. Object type  . . . . :   *LIB
  5. Object secured by authorization list  . . . . . . . . . . . . :   MYLIST
  6.                           Object
  7. User        Group       Authority
  8. USR5184                 *ALL
  9. QTMHHTP1                *ALL
  10. USR4093                 *CHANGE
  11. *PUBLIC                 *ALL
复制代码

这是WRKOBJ USR5184看到的这个库的授权的信息,


  1.                             Display Object Authority
  2. Object . . . . . . . :   QRPGSRC         Owner  . . . . . . . :   USR5184
  3.    Library  . . . . . :     USR5184       Primary group  . . . :   *NONE
  4. Object type  . . . . :   *FILE
  5. Object secured by authorization list  . . . . . . . . . . . . :   *NONE
  6.                           Object
  7. User        Group       Authority
  8. *PUBLIC                 *CHANGE

复制代码

这是USR5184库下QRPGSRC这个OBJ的授权,但是我无权更改其下的SOURCE MEMBER,

  1.                           Display Library Description
  2. Library  . . . . . . . . . . . . . . . . . :   USR5184
  3. Type . . . . . . . . . . . . . . . . . . . :   PROD
  4. ASP of library . . . . . . . . . . . . . . :   1
  5. Create authority . . . . . . . . . . . . . :   *SYSVAL
  6. Create object auditing . . . . . . . . . . :   *SYSVAL
  7. Text description . . . . . . . . . . . . . :   
复制代码

这是WRKLIB的Library Description。

用DSPSYSVAL SYSVAL(QCRTAUT)看到的系统值是*CHANGE,
DSPSYSVAL SYSVAL(QCRTOBJAUD)  ,值为*NONE。
不明白     

论坛徽章:
0
15 [报告]
发表于 2004-03-31 10:15 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

看看MYLIST这个authority list里是什么??

论坛徽章:
0
16 [报告]
发表于 2004-03-31 11:19 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

in concern!

论坛徽章:
0
17 [报告]
发表于 2004-03-31 11:24 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

mylist的描述:
  1.                       Display Object Description - Full
  2.                                                                 Library 1 of 1
  3. Object . . . . . . . :   MYLIST          Attribute  . . . . . :
  4.   Library  . . . . . :     QSYS          Owner  . . . . . . . :   USR4195
  5. Type . . . . . . . . :   *AUTL           Primary group  . . . :   *NONE
  6. User-defined information:
  7.   Attribute  . . . . . . . . . . . . :
  8.   Text . . . . . . . . . . . . . . . :
  9. Creation information:
  10.   Creation date/time . . . . . . . . :   03/03/04  08:26:43
  11.   Created by user  . . . . . . . . . :   USR4195
  12.   System created on  . . . . . . . . :   S102Y34M
  13.   Object domain  . . . . . . . . . . :   *SYSTEM
复制代码


mylist的内容:

  1.                            Display Authorization List
  2. Object . . . . . . . :   MYLIST          Owner  . . . . . . . :   USR4195
  3.    Library  . . . . . :     QSYS          Primary group  . . . :   *NONE
  4.               Object    ---------------Data---------------
  5. User        Authority  Read  Add  Update  Delete  Execute
  6. USR4195     *ALL        X     X     X       X        X
  7. USR4576     *USE        X                            X
  8. USR4894     *USE        X                            X
  9. *PUBLIC     *CHANGE     X     X     X       X        X
复制代码

我的用户的profile中比较特殊的一点就是开始的时候调用了一个SOC000的CLP程序,但是我在看其源文件如下,是不是有些问题?


  1.              PGM
  2.              DCL        VAR(&USR) TYPE(*CHAR) LEN(10)
  3.              RTVJOBA    USER(&USR)
  4.              OVRDBF     FILE(SO) TOFILE(SOLIB/SO)
  5.              CALL       PGM(SOLIB/SOR000) PARM(&USR)
  6.              DLTOVR     FILE(SO)
  7.              CHKOBJ     OBJ(&USR/SOC000) OBJTYPE(*PGM)
  8.              MONMSG     MSGID(CPF0000) EXEC(GOTO CMDLBL(EOJ))
  9.              CALL       PGM(&USR/SOC000)
  10. EOJ:
复制代码

看其他用户的profile没法看,想用RTVCLSRC来直接提取源码还没有权限,无奈           

论坛徽章:
0
18 [报告]
发表于 2004-03-31 11:42 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

这个程序只是LOG你的登陆信息罢了 没有限制权限的

论坛徽章:
0
19 [报告]
发表于 2004-03-31 11:55 |只看该作者

关于LIB及其下的OBJECT的使用权限的问题

给*ALL的权限是可以更改的 我试过了 必须要有OBJ管理权限才可以 *CHANGE是不行的
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P